Course Registration: Get Started
Course registration is an important part of your undergraduate experience at ECU. This section helps you get set up to register, understand course types and credit loads, choose your semester, plan your courses and register.
Registration Basics
- Register through MyEC/Student Planner
- We’ll email you your personal registration date and time — register as soon as it opens
- Beforehand, choose your semester and set up your course plan and schedule
